
Director, Compliance (Privacy Compliance Monitoring)
- 서울시
- 정규직
- 풀타임
- Establishment and management of a monitoring system for compliance with privacy regulations
- Establish and implement a plan to monitor compliance with privacy regulations
- Suggest remediations or alternatives to defects identified through monitoring
- Assess privacy compliance risks and set priorities based on risk level
- Help mitigate and improve privacy compliance risks
- Bachelor's Degree is required.
- More than 12 years of privacy compliance monitoring experience
- Ability to review and provide guidance on personal information compliance issues.
- Experience in personal information flow analysis and PI flow-based management
- Communication skills to effectively collaborate with various internal and external stakeholders.
- Passion for taking initiative and solving problems
- A deep understanding and practical experience with the Korean Personal Information Protection Act are required.
- High level of experience and understanding of cloud-based service environments
- Experienced in personal information protection work at e-commerce, IT companies, etc.
- Possession of domestic/international certifications related privacy compliance.(CPPG, CISA, CISSP, ISMS-P, ISO27001, Engineer information security, etc)
